As per TANCET Exam Pattern, it will be an offline test of 2-hour duration having 100 MCQs of 1 mark each. There is a negative marking of 0.33 marks. The paper will be set in English only. TANCET Syllabus is different for MCA, MBA, M.Tech/M.E, M.Arch and M.Planning programs.
TANCET 2019 exam for M.Tech or M.Arch and other technical courses decides whether the candidate is eligible for admission to the state colleges of Tamil Nadu. Question Paper comprises of three parts.
1. Part I and Part II are mandatory for the applicants while they have to choose the Part III’s subject at the time of registration.
2. Part III is chosen according to the course the candidate wants to pursue.
There are different papers for different courses in the state level exam but similar marking scheme is followed in all tests. Let’s have a look into the marking scheme of this exam:
1. TANCET question paper is of 100 marks containing 100 multiple choice questions.
2. Each question carries 1 mark.
3. Candidates lose 1/3 marks for every incorrect response.
4. If a student marks more than one option in a single question in TANCET 2019, it is counted as wrong and negative marking is done.
5. Questions left unanswered are ignored while checking the OMR. No marks are given/ deducted for such questions.
